Article III After a determination by the President of the United States of America that any of the articles and services set forth in Schedule 1 are no longer necessary to the prosecution of the war, the United States of America will transfer or render, within such periods of time as may be authorized by law, and the Provisional Government of the French Republic will accept, such articles and services as shall not have been transferred or rendered to the Provisional Government of the French Republic prior to said determination. The Provisional Government of the French Republic undertakes to pay the United States of America in dollars for the articles and services transferred or rendered under the provisions of this Article in accordance with the terms and conditions prescribed in Schedule 1 annexed hereto. Article IV The United States of America undertakes to transfer to the Pro- visional Government of the French Republic, within such periods of time as may be authorized by law, and the Provisional Government of the French Republic agrees to accept, the defense articles set forth in Schedule 2, annexed hereto. The Provisional Government of the French Republic undertakes to pay the United States of America in dollars for the articles transferred under the provisions of this Article in accordance with the terms and conditions prescribed in said Schedule 2. Article V Changes may be made from time to time in the items set forth in Schedules 1 and 2 annexed hereto, by mutual agreement between the United States of America and the Provisional Government of the French Republic.
